Matthew Goldman Finds Runner-Runner Redemption

Level 21 : 6,000/12,000, 2,000 ante
Dan Kelly During Day 3 Action
Dan Kelly During Day 3 Action

As this Day 3 progresses at a torrid pace, the players have been pushing their chips around the table early and often. Matthew Goldman was the latest to get his stack into the middle, but his {6-Clubs}{6-Spades} was crushed by the {Q-Diamonds}{Q-Clubs} held by Dan Kelly.

A flop of {K-Clubs}{4-Diamonds}{5-Hearts} appeared to be quite safe for Kelly's overpair, but the presence of connected low cards must have been a bit disconcerting. The {7-Diamonds} on the turn confirmed those fears, offering Goldman a lifeline in the form of an open-ended straight draw.

River: {3-Hearts}

Just like that, Goldman had doubled his stack of 240,000 through the dangerous Kelly, and he now sits with an average stack.

Ryan Welch Triples Up

Level 21 : 6,000/12,000, 2,000 ante

Anthony Maio raised to 26,000 from under the gun and Ryan Welch three-bet all in for 108,000 from UTG+2. Joe Kuether called on the button before Maio eventually reraised all in for a little bit more. Kuether called.

Maio: {A-Spades}{Q-Spades}
Kuether: {A-Hearts}{K-Clubs}
Welch: {5-Hearts}{5-Clubs}

The flop came down {A-Diamonds}{8-Clubs}{2-Clubs}, giving Kuther a comfortable lead. However, he lost out on the double elimination as the {5-Spades} turn gave Welch a set to win the main pot. Adding insult to injury, the {Q-Diamonds} river fell to give Maio two pair to survive.

Benny Chen Chases One Off

Level 22 : 8,000/16,000, 2,000 ante

With one of the biggest stacks left in the Amazon Room's Tan section, Benny Chen is playing power poker to perfection.

On a flop of {5-Clubs}{9-Spades}{3-Hearts}, the small blind led out for 34,000 and Chen flatted to see the turn. After the {7-Spades} arrived, Chen's opponent continued again, this time for 40,000. After a moment of thought, Chen announced himself all-in, effectively forcing the smaller stack to a test for his tournament life.

This pressure proved to be too intense, and the player mucked his cards, sending yet another pot in Chen's direction.

Khammy Lim's Loss Leaves Us Lady-less

Level 22 : 8,000/16,000, 2,000 ante

The last woman left in contention for the "Millionaire Maker" crown has just been eliminated, leaving the fellas to compete for the seven-figure payday.

With her stack dwindling and blinds chipping away at her stack, Khammy Lim shoved all-in from under the gun with {A-Spades}{J-Hearts}. Her bet of 121,000 was called by a player in the big blind who tabled {A-Hearts}{Q-Clubs}, dominating Lim's ace and putting her in a deep hole.

The flop fell {9-Diamonds}{8-Clubs}{4-Diamonds} and Lim was in desperate need of a jack on the turn or river, but running deuces left her outkicked and out of the tournament.

Justin Liberto Fills Up the Tank

Level 22 : 8,000/16,000, 2,000 ante

The shorter stacks are being forced to move their chips if they hope to stay in contention, and Jason Liberto did just that with {A-Diamonds}{K-Clubs}. He got his last 150,000 or so chips into the middle before the flop, and was called in one spot by an opponent holding {5-Hearts}{5-Diamonds}.

The flop of {K-Diamonds}{3-Hearts}{K-Spades} vaulted Liberto into the led with trip kings, and the {A-Clubs} secured his double up, leaving his opponent with no outs in the deck.
